Transaction 67430afecf987165686270f1936b005ca65408ce59c058f9b85f9163c2b0a443
1 Input
1 Output
-
67430afecf987165686270f1936b005ca65408ce59c058f9b85f9163c2b0a443:0
- value
- 14928565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 172a4a1d949783dad71e3aca09ee046dcaf55eae OP_EQUAL
- address
- 33oW8HMZAYfMd5q3V1EsYBeSNXnJZJ1yoG